Method
- Start by grating the zucchinis using a box grater or a food processor. After grating, place the zucchini in a clean kitchen towel and squeeze out any excess moisture.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and black pepper. Whisk until all dry ingredients are mixed evenly.
- In another bowl, beat the eggs until frothy, then add the ricotta cheese, Parmesan, and chopped herbs. Mix until creamy and well combined.
- Gently incorporate the grated zucchini, sweet corn, diced onion, and minced garlic into the wet mixture. Then, fold this blend into the dry mixture using a spatula until just combined.
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9x13-inch baking dish with olive oil, then pour in the batter, spreading it evenly. Bake for about 40-45 minutes, or until the center is set.
- Once baked, allow the zucchini slice to cool slightly before cutting it into squares.
